Navigating Contested Divorce Laws in South Africa
Divorce proceedings in South Africa can be complex, especially when spouses cannot reach an understanding on key issues. This situation leads to unresolved divorce cases. In such scenarios, the court plays a crucial role in settling disputes and determining a fair result.
- Spouses involved in a contested divorce must participate in legal proceedings before the court.
- A lawyer is typically required to represent each party's interests throughout the process.
- Documents relevant to the matters at hand, such as financial records and testimony, are presented to the court.
- The judge will meticulously consider all elements before delivering a final ruling.
